Output 50f592ffd6202725a9f7df484459df377051459d78e72aed45e4f43c20a54d08:0

value
4499990654
script pubkey
OP_0 OP_PUSHBYTES_20 d93ae3b9b20d854bb172fcf56861bb2123636df9
address
tb1qmyaw8wdjpkz5hvtjln6kscdmyy3kxm0e8d9fme
transaction
50f592ffd6202725a9f7df484459df377051459d78e72aed45e4f43c20a54d08
confirmations
223708
spent
true